Tmarkets.xyz, a website only 138 days old, is orchestrating an investment scam. The contact numbers listed on the site are non-functional, and the physical address provided is false as no such business exists there. Despite the lack of a social media presence, the website promises substantial returns on investments. However, once the money is sent, the fraudsters abscond with it.

An investment scam involves a scheme where fraudsters trick individuals into parting with their money, promising high returns on investments. However, once the money is sent, the scammers simply take it and vanish.

An investment scam is a scheme to defraud investors. Scammers promise high returns with little risk. They create a sense of urgency, pressuring you to invest immediately. These scams often involve unregistered securities. Scammers may use complex jargon to confuse you. They might also offer exclusive opportunities. A common tactic is the "Ponzi" scheme. Here, returns for older investors are paid by new investors. This creates an illusion of a profitable investment. When new investors stop coming in, the scheme collapses. Scammers may also manipulate stock prices. This is known as a "pump and dump" scam. They inflate a stock's price, then sell their shares before the price crashes. Remember, if an investment sounds too good to be true, it probably is. Don't let greed cloud your judgment.
